Что такое процесс, использование, безопасность или вирус msdtc.exe?
Msdtc.exe является компонентом операционной системы Windows и расшифровывается как Microsoft Distributed Transaction Console. Процесс транзакции обычно выполняется с архитектурами COM и .NET и обычно используется для транзакций между несколькими компьютерами.
Полная форма MSDTC — координатор распределенных транзакций Microsoft, разработанный для операционной системы Windows.
Размер и местоположение файла
Это приложение Msdtc.exe находится в каталоге C:\Windows\System32, а размер файла составляет около 145 КБ в Windows 10, однако размер может увеличиваться и уменьшаться в зависимости от версии файла или системы.
Краткая информация
Имя файла:msdtc.exeОписание файла:Microsoft Distributed Transaction Coordinator ServiceВерсия файла:2001.12.8530.16385Размер файла:140 КБНазвание продукта:Microsoft@Windows@Operating SystemТип файла:ПриложениеАвторское право:Microsoft CorporationЯзык:Английский
Каково использование Msdtc.exe?
Этот инструмент необходим для запуска Microsoft SQL Server или Microsoft Personal Web Server на локальном или серверном компьютере. Это означает, что если вы разрабатываете веб-сайт или проектируете базу данных, вам необходим этот инструмент. Сервер SQL больше похож на Xampp, который позволяет запускать сервер на локальном ПК для разработки веб-сайта.
Msdtc.exe безопасный или вирус?
Хотите знать, является ли Msdtc.exe вирусом или безопасным? Что ж, подлинный процесс Msdtc.exe — это безопасный файл, известный как служба координатора распределенных транзакций Microsoft. Чтобы узнать, безопасен ли Msdtc, сначала проверьте расположение его файла. Если он находится в папке C:\Windows\System32, то он безопасен. Другой способ проверки — выполнить следующие шаги:
1) Щелкните правой кнопкой мыши Msdtc.exe.
2) Выберите «Свойства» и перейдите на вкладку «Подробности».
3) Проверьте, не упоминается ли в описании файла «Служба координатора распределенных транзакций Microsoft».
4) Если он там указан, то это не вирус.
Как работает распределенная транзакция?
Распределенные транзакции проводятся в два этапа; во-первых, намерение совершить транзакцию должно быть подтверждено, а во-вторых, после одобрения ресурсов они выполняют окончательный коммит.
Менеджеры для распределенных транзакций важны, поскольку сами распределенные транзакции сложно реализовать, поскольку они проходят через несколько баз данных.
Зачем нам нужны распределенные транзакции?
Они необходимы для обновления подключенной информации в нескольких базах данных и используются в основном в службах, требующих постоянного обновления. Они также важны для потоковой передачи данных.
Msdtc.exe используется сервером SQL, а также другими соответствующими клиентами и отвечает за организацию транзакций, в которых участвуют несколько диспетчеров ресурсов, таких как базы данных и файловая система. После выполнения необходимых транзакций программа затем фиксирует распределенную транзакцию среди различных других соответствующих серверов. Его «защита транзакций» гарантирует, что затронутые файлы или базы данных, участвующие в любых сложных процессах, не будут полностью обновлены до тех пор, пока процессы не будут полностью успешными; любые сбои или задержки не будут сохранены в системе.
msdtc.exe используется для предоставления консольной программы приложению, и этот файл обычно интенсивно использует ЦП.
Этот исполняемый файл доступен для версий Windows и обычно устанавливается программами Windows, которым требуются его службы, например Microsoft SQL Server и Microsoft Personal Web Server. Процесс связан с сервером в Интернете или локальной сети. По сути, он координирует взаимодействие системы с системой Microsoft Component Object Model (COM), которая управляет действием DTC. Основная функциональность COM заключается в реализации веществ независимым от языка способом для систем, которые были запрограммированы в другой среде. Это позволяет осуществлять транзакции между совершенно разными машинами.
Другие процессы:
Tvnserver.exe, BTServer.exe, csrss.exe